You've probably heard them already but one suggestion from seeing your listed bands is Evergrey. They're heavy, melodic and a bit progressive. I'd recommend the albums In Search of Truth and Solitude Dominance Tragedy and to a lesser extent Recreation Day (though it might be the easiest album to get into).
